A Lease is legally-binding contract utilized when a Property manager, the "lessor," rents residential or commercial property to a Tenant, the "lessee." The Lease offers all of the terms under which a residential or commercial property is rented and describes functions, responsibilities, rules and regulations, and policies. It safeguards both parties need to a dispute arise and provides the structure for handling any conflicts. It is essential anytime you lease a residential or commercial property.

If it is a fixed term Lease, it will clearly provide an end date. Most Leases are repaired term and supply a beginning and ending date. Even if your Lease is repaired term, it likely will provide the terms under which the Tenant can extend the Lease duration.

Both a Lease and a Rental Agreement are legally-binding agreements between a Landlord and Tenant The distinction between a Lease and a rental contract is the period of the contract.

A Lease is generally a long-term agreement, ranging in between 12 and 24 months, while a rental agreement is a short-term contract for simply a few weeks or months.

Often, the terms Lease and rental arrangement are used interchangeably. That said, to prevent any confusion, we normally describe longer-term agreements as Leases and use the expression rental arrangement for a short-term contract with an end date that's generally around one month away.

What is the Difference between a Rental Application and a Rental Agreement?

The rental application and rental arrangement are simple to puzzle but they serve extremely various purposes.

The rental app is utilized to assist the Landlord screen applicants and pick a qualified Tenant. It is not a rental contract and is not a legally-binding file. That stated, it's extremely essential. A Landlord must always evaluate Applicants before they lease a residential or commercial property. This helps to ensure that the prospective Tenant can pay lease and will be a trustworthy occupant.

On the other hand, a rental arrangement creates a legal relationship between the Landlord and Tenant that defines the terms under which an Occupant leases a residential or commercial property from the Landlord. As talked about, the rental agreement is also an essential document and must be completed before Landlords rent residential or commercial property to an Occupant.

What if a Renter Violates a Regard To the Lease?

If an Occupant violates the Lease, the first thing the Landlord ought to do is interact with the Tenant and effort to fix the issue. The reality is that often Tenants do not even understand they're breaching the Lease, so a simple discussion can sometimes resolve the issue.

For instance, if a Renter is regularly late with every month's lease and doesn't pay lease by the due date, the Landlord ought to:

- reach out to the Tenant. - share issues about the month's rent and the value of paying lease on the due date

  • remind the Tenant when the month's lease is due pursuant to the Lease
  • discuss late costs related to rent
  • provide any assistance possible to ensure that the Tenant pays monthly's lease on time.

    This initial discussion may solve the issue.

    If the Tenant continues to be late with paying rent and continues violating the rental arrangement, you might require to think about more drastic actions. In some circumstances, this indicates thinking about the actions required to end the residential rental or property Lease Agreement.

    A great location to begin is typically a Notification to Vacate, which is an official demand asking the Tenant to voluntarily leave by a specific date. In this Notice, the Landlord must interact the problem and plainly interact that the Tenant needs to leave.

    If the Tenant does not comply with that request and continues breaking the Lease, then the Landlord will need to release an eviction warning and, potentially, start eviction procedures.

    What does Governing Law indicate?

    When you hear governing law in the context of a Lease, it implies the laws that apply to the Lease. A property Lease is governed by the state laws where the rental residential or commercial property is situated. Should any conflicts develop, the celebrations would be in the jurisdiction of the state courts where the residential or commercial property sits.

    For example, if you live in New york city however have a rental system in Florida, Florida law would be the governing law. This indicates that when the Lease is prepared, it needs to abide by all of Florida's suitable laws.

    What are the Main Responsibilities of Landlords?

    The specific responsibilities of Landlords will be laid out in the Lease. That said, every Landlord has a responsibility to Tenants to preserve a warranty of habitability, which implies that the residential or commercial property satisfies standard security and living requirements

    This is a fundamental ideal paid for to all Tenants in the United States regardless of the of the Lease. This indicates that as a standard, Landlords are accountable for keeping up with security codes and guaranteeing that the residential or commercial property they lease is habitable and safe for residents.

    Beyond this inherent right, other responsibilities will be particularly described in the Lease Agreement and usually include handling residential or commercial property maintenance, residential or commercial property management, resolving issues caused by regular wear and tear, and making residential or commercial property repairs.

    In addition, Landlords are accountable for keeping up with monetary commitments consisting of paying residential or commercial property insurance, taxes and, if applicable, the mortgage.

    What is an Option to Purchase and When Should I Include it in my Lease Agreement?

    A Lease Agreement with an Alternative to Purchase is just a Lease Agreement that includes an alternative for the Tenant to acquire the rental residential or commercial property during the Lease duration. It contains all of the very same terms as a typical domestic Lease Agreement, however in addition, it also includes an offer from the Landlord for the Tenant to buy the residential rental residential or commercial property before completion of the Lease.

    For a Property owner that is open to or interested in offering the residential or commercial property they rent, this can be a great term to consist of.

    And, it is essential to note, that even if your existing domestic Lease Agreement does not include this alternative, you can always add an alternative to purchase the residential or commercial property with a Lease Purchase Option type.
